dc:description.abstractThis work refers to the application of rupture method on designing of bridge slabs. We have studied only the effect of the heavy vehicle of six wheels. We have tested 5 models, being 3 separeted and just supported by the 4 sides, and 2 continuous slabs that have been previously dimensioned, according to the calculated results by numbers obtained by Prof. Polillo, working with straight configurations of rupture. We have compared the test results with that of elastic classic methods and with numbers of rupture method. We have concluded, in all of our tests, by the use of the rupture method (straight configurations) that, besides its comproved safety, it is the more economical.
